Safety features
Overheating protection / Pan
protection
Each cooking zone is equipped with
overheating protection (internal
temperature limiter).
The ExtraSpeed cooking zone is also
equipped with a pan protection
mechanism. If you wish to use this
feature, you will need to alter the factory
setting (see "Programming").
If the overheating protection has
switched on, the heating element
switches on and off even when the
highest power level is selected.
If the pan protection has been
activated, the heating element for the
cooking zone switches off.  will flash
alternately with  on the ExtraSpeed
cooking zone's numerical keybank.

The overheating protection and the pan
protection switch on in the following
situations:
– A pan unsuitable for use with an
induction hob is being used or no
pan is on the cooking zone.
– The pan being used is empty.
– The base of a pan not sitting evenly
on the cooking zone.
– The pan is not conducting heat
properly.
You can tell that the overheating
protection has activated because the
heating element switches on and off
even when the highest power level is
selected.
